Former member of court-sponsored program arrested for threats
A man recently dismissed from a court-sponsored program in Washington County, Tennessee threatened a court employee using a series of text messages, according to police.
Matthew Dykes Clark, 28, of Johnson City is charged with retaliation for past action, harassment, and simple assault after deputies were alerted to those notes that investigators said were traced back to Clark’s phone.
The report said Clark also made threats to others associated with the program. He is scheduled for an appearance in Sessions Court on Wednesday.
